[PATCH 2/7] ieee1275: encode-unit command for 4 addr cell devs


From: Eric Snowberg
Subject: [PATCH 2/7] ieee1275: encode-unit command for 4 addr cell devs
Date: Mon, 26 Feb 2018 17:34:15 -0800

Convert physical address to text unit-string.

Convert phys.lo ... phys-high, the numerical representation, to unit-string,
the text string representation of a physical address within the address
space defined by this device node. The number of cells in the list
phys.lo ... phys.hi is determined by the value of the #address-cells property
of this node.

This function is for devices with #address-cells == 4

 grub-core/kern/ieee1275/ieee1275.c |   46 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++
 include/grub/ieee1275/ieee1275.h   |    7 +++++
 2 files changed, 53 insertions(+), 0 deletions(-)

diff --git a/grub-core/kern/ieee1275/ieee1275.c 
b/grub-core/kern/ieee1275/ieee1275.c
index 4617b36..7aef624 100644
--- a/grub-core/kern/ieee1275/ieee1275.c
+++ b/grub-core/kern/ieee1275/ieee1275.c
@@ -19,6 +19,7 @@
 
 #include <grub/ieee1275/ieee1275.h>
 #include <grub/types.h>
+#include <grub/misc.h>
 
 #define IEEE1275_PHANDLE_INVALID  ((grub_ieee1275_cell_t) -1)
 #define IEEE1275_IHANDLE_INVALID  ((grub_ieee1275_cell_t) 0)
@@ -523,6 +524,51 @@ grub_ieee1275_decode_unit4 (grub_ieee1275_ihandle_t 
ihandle,
   return 0;
 }
 
+char *
+grub_ieee1275_encode_uint4 (grub_ieee1275_ihandle_t ihandle,
+                            grub_uint32_t phy_lo, grub_uint32_t phy_hi,
+                            grub_uint32_t lun_lo, grub_uint32_t lun_hi,
+                            grub_size_t *size)
+{
+  char *addr;
+  struct encode_args
+  {
+    struct grub_ieee1275_common_hdr common;
+    grub_ieee1275_cell_t method;
+    grub_ieee1275_cell_t ihandle;
+    grub_ieee1275_cell_t tgt_h;
+    grub_ieee1275_cell_t tgt_l;
+    grub_ieee1275_cell_t lun_h;
+    grub_ieee1275_cell_t lun_l;
+    grub_ieee1275_cell_t catch_result;
+    grub_ieee1275_cell_t size;
+    grub_ieee1275_cell_t addr;
+  }
+  args;
+
+  INIT_IEEE1275_COMMON (&args.common, "call-method", 6, 3);
+  args.method = (grub_ieee1275_cell_t) "encode-unit";
+  args.ihandle = ihandle;
+
+  args.tgt_l = phy_lo;
+  args.tgt_h = phy_hi;
+  args.lun_l = lun_lo;
+  args.lun_h = lun_hi;
+  args.catch_result = 1;
+
+  if ((IEEE1275_CALL_ENTRY_FN (&args) == -1) || (args.catch_result))
+    {
+      grub_error (GRUB_ERR_OUT_OF_RANGE, "encode-unit failed\n");
+      return 0;
+    }
+
+  addr = (void *)args.addr;
+  *size = args.size;
+  addr = grub_strdup ((char *)args.addr);
+  return addr;
+}
+
+
 
 int
 grub_ieee1275_claim (grub_addr_t addr, grub_size_t size, unsigned int align,
diff --git a/include/grub/ieee1275/ieee1275.h b/include/grub/ieee1275/ieee1275.h
index b1940c2..5404ed6 100644
--- a/include/grub/ieee1275/ieee1275.h
+++ b/include/grub/ieee1275/ieee1275.h
@@ -218,6 +218,13 @@ int EXPORT_FUNC(grub_ieee1275_decode_unit4) 
(grub_ieee1275_ihandle_t ihandle,
                                              grub_uint32_t *lun_lo,
                                              grub_uint32_t *lun_hi);
 
+char *EXPORT_FUNC(grub_ieee1275_encode_uint4) (grub_ieee1275_ihandle_t ihandle,
+                                             grub_uint32_t phy_lo,
+                                             grub_uint32_t phy_hi,
+                                             grub_uint32_t lun_lo,
+                                             grub_uint32_t lun_hi,
+                                             grub_size_t *size);
+
 
 
 grub_err_t EXPORT_FUNC(grub_claimmap) (grub_addr_t addr, grub_size_t size);
